27 year old Charles Bowman of Severn, Maryland entered guilty pleas to Forgery charges as a result of passing several forged checks in Queen Anne’s County. Bowman pled guilty to forgery in two separate cases in which Bowman was involved in a statewide conspiracy to pass forged checks in banks across the State.  Bowman forged and passed checks in Queen Anne’s County on May 19, 2014 and June 2, 2014 and has also been charged with passing forged checks in seven other counties throughout Maryland.

Mr. Bowman had been serving a jail sentence in Caroline County Department of Corrections and was sentenced on May 5, 2015 in the Queen Anne’s County Circuit Court to an additional 3 1/2 years of incarceration for the Queen Anne’s County portion of the crime spree.

This case was prosecuted by Assistant State’s Attorney Leigh Darrell Dillon.
